The owners of Waters of Superior, an art gallery and boutique in Duluth’s Canal Park, announced Thursday that they would be permanently closing the shop Oct. 25 due to COVID-19.
Co-owners Jeff Frey and Craig Blacklock, both of whom are also photographers, said in a news release that COVID-19 has reduced sales at the shop “dramatically.”
“And projections showed it would have been impossible to make it through the winter and spring, especially without Duluth’s normal convention business,” the news release said.
The business started in Grand Marais in 1999. The following year, the Canal Park store opened at 395 S. Lake Ave.
The store will offer closing sales beginning Friday.
